§ 325E.115 — LEAD ACID BATTERIES; COLLECTION FOR RECYCLING

Subdivision 1.Surcharge; collection; notice.

(a)A person selling lead acid batteries at retail or offering lead acid batteries for retail sale in this state shall:
(1)accept, at the point of transfer, lead acid batteries from customers;
(2)charge a fee of at least $10 per battery sold unless the customer returns a used battery to the retailer; and
(3)post written notice in accordance with section325E.1151.
(b)Any person selling lead acid batteries at wholesale or offering lead acid batteries for sale at wholesale must accept, at the point of transfer, lead acid batteries from customers. Subd. 2.Compliance; management. The commissioner of the Pollution Control Agency shall inform persons governed by subdivision 1 of requirements for managing lead acid batteries.
